Go to Device Manager > Network Adapters, select Wifi adapter, then Power Management tab, clear the check box to "Allow the computer to turn off the device to save energy." Then on the Advanced tab disable any energy-saving options. 3) Enable IPv6 here: How to Disable/Enable IPv6 in Windows 11 or 10.
